Classical spotlight: Accordo opens season with a double-header

October 13, 2014 at 12:43PM

DOUBLEHEADER BY ACCORDO

Monday-Tuesday: To open the sixth season of chamber ensemble Accordo on Monday, St. Paul Chamber Orchestra concertmaster Steven Copes, associate concert master Ruggero Allifranchini and principal viola Maiya Papach, plus Minnesota Orchestra principal cello Anthony Ross, will play Haydn's String Quartet in G minor. They are joined by a guest, SPCO principal bass Zachary Cohen, for Dvorak's String Quintet No. 2 and "Waltzes" by contemporary American composer Fred Lerdahl. The next evening, the program "Accordo at Amsterdam" offers audiences a chance to explore Mozart and Brahms string quintets with the musicians over drinks. (7:30 p.m. Mon., Christ Church Lutheran, 3244 34th Av. S., Mpls., $12-$25; 6:30 p.m. Tue., Amsterdam Bar & Hall, 6 W. 6th St., St. Paul, $20-$25. 651-292-3268, www.schubert.org/accordo.)
